  • Upgraded to Lion. Can't see files on my backup drive?

    The title pretty much explains my issue, but here is my situation. I use Boot Camp and have a 2TB backup drive with 2 partitions. One partition is 1TB Mac OS Extended (Journaled) to backup OS X with Time Machine and the other is 1TB Windows NTFS to back up Windows 7 with Windows Backup.
    So on the OS X side of things I upgraded from Snow Leopard to Lion. Now I can still backup to the Mac OS Extended (Journaled) partition with Time Machine but I can't see any backups or any files at all that I put on the backup drive while i'm in OS X Lion. I know they are there because When I'm in Windows 7 I can still see all Time Machine backups and all files on both partitions of the backup drive.
    Any Idea why I can't view files on my backup drive anymore since upgrading to Lion or how to fix this issue?

    SOLVED:
    I was reading a post about a similar problem and discovered a free program called TinkerTool. I downloaded it and under the Finder tab was able to check a feature called show all hidden files or something. Once I did this all files on my backup drive were visible but some were greyed out.
    I unchecked this feature and closed TinkerTools then restarted OS X Lion. Everything is back to normal and I can again see and manipulate the files on my backup drive. I'm all set, maybe reading this will help someone else.

  • Can't see files that are backedup

    I have a G4 iMac that has both an internal (small) and external (large) drive that I use for data. I am using a time capsule to backup the whole system.
    When I run Time Machine it appears to backup both disks, the log file shows both drives having many GBs of data being transferred without any errors.
    However, when I go into the TM application, I can only see files that are on the internal drive. I can only see my external 'LaCie HFS' in the Now view, going back in time that drive is greyed out.
    If I use the finder when the TC is mounted, I can traverse into 'Backup.backupdb/iMac/2009-08-074700' and I can see the 'LaCie HFS' folder and in it are all my backed up files.
    I have looked through the FAQ and various postings but cannot find an answer.
    The closest thing that I can see as being a potential problem is that my old internal drive uses an Apple Partition Map while my new external drive uses a GUID Partition Table.
    Why would backupd created backups that Time Machine cannot see?

    Hi, and welcome to the forums.
    Try this: Open a Finder window and press ShiftCmdC (or select your computer name in the Finder Sidebar).
    Then +Enter Time Machine.+
    On the first Finder window in the "cascade," labelled Now, you'll see all the volumes currently attached to your Mac.
    Select the Finder window for any backup, and you'll see a folder for each drive/volume that was backed-up, including any that are no longer connected. Navigate from there to whatever you're looking for.

  • I can't see two of my internal drives on my mac pro?

    I can't see two of my internal drives on my mac pro?  Any idea's or suggestions on how I can see them again.  They were working last week just fine - Now they don't even show up in the finder? I have video stored on one and the other is just used for extra storage if needed - not really used much.

    A drive that will not show BOTH its Make&Model AND a reasonable Size/capacity in Disk Utility has failed.
    IF Disk Utility can see those things, use (Repair Disk) to attempt to repair its Directory. It takes about five minutes. If it finishes in 10 seconds, it just repaired the Partition Map and nothing else. Select the Macintosh_HD or whatever you renamed the Volume, and (Repair Disk) again.
